What Are Dangerous Liaisons?

Dangerous liaisons refer to relationships characterized by deceit, manipulation, and emotional instability. These connections often involve a power imbalance, where one party seeks to exploit the other for personal gain. The term gained popularity from the epistolary novel "Les Liaisons Dangereuses" by Pierre Choderlos de Laclos, published in 1782, which explores themes of seduction and betrayal among the French aristocracy.

In modern contexts, dangerous liaisons can manifest in various forms, including romantic relationships, friendships, and even professional partnerships. The underlying elements remain consistent: emotional volatility, risk-taking behavior, and the potential for devastating consequences.

The Psychology Behind Dangerous Liaisons

The psychology of dangerous liaisons is complex, often rooted in deep-seated emotional issues and unmet needs. Here are some key psychological factors that contribute to the formation of these relationships:

  • Narcissism: Individuals with narcissistic tendencies may engage in dangerous liaisons to fulfill their need for admiration and control over others.
  • Low Self-Esteem: People with low self-esteem may enter into toxic relationships seeking validation and affection, even if it comes at a high emotional cost.
  • Fear of Abandonment: Those with a fear of abandonment may tolerate unhealthy dynamics in their relationships, believing that any connection is better than being alone.

Emotional Manipulation

Emotional manipulation is a common tactic used in dangerous liaisons. Manipulators may employ tactics such as gaslighting, guilt-tripping, and love-bombing to control their partners and maintain power in the relationship. Recognizing these behaviors is essential for individuals to protect themselves from emotional harm.

Attachment Styles

Attachment theory explains how early relationships with caregivers shape our adult relationships. Individuals with insecure attachment styles may be more prone to engaging in dangerous liaisons, as they often seek out relationships that replicate their childhood dynamics.

Dangerous Liaisons in Literature and Film

Dangerous liaisons have been a popular theme in literature and film for centuries. Here are some notable examples:

  • Les Liaisons Dangereuses: The original novel by Laclos serves as a timeless exploration of manipulation and seduction.
  • Fatal Attraction: This 1987 film portrays the consequences of a brief affair that spirals out of control, showcasing the dangers of infidelity.
  • Gone Girl: Gillian Flynn's novel and its film adaptation delve into the dark complexities of marriage, highlighting the lengths individuals will go to for revenge.

Recognizing the Warning Signs

Identifying the warning signs of a dangerous liaison can help individuals protect themselves from emotional harm. Some key indicators include:

  • Excessive jealousy or possessiveness from a partner.
  • Manipulative behaviors, such as guilt-tripping or gaslighting.
  • Isolation from friends and family.
  • Constant feelings of anxiety or fear in the relationship.
